Jess grew up in a family home in rural Australia; a family home where Country and Top 40 were the main constituents of the musical diet. Armed only with an out-of-tune piano, she set out to compose music that would break away from all that surrounded her. To get an idea, imagine an artist whose music evokes thoughts of Tori Amos, The Cranberries, Bjork and Alanis Morissette and you are starting to get close.
After graduating from high school at age 17, in 2004, she moved from her Central-Queensland family home to the Gold Coast to commence a Bachelor of Popular Music Degree with the Conservatorium of Music. It was whilst studying there that her musical eclecticism stopped being a point of confusion for her and actually became something that she would grow to embrace; something which would define her personality as a singer/songwriter.
Having put together a recorded body of work during her degree, Jess is taking her music to the world. Germany and Ireland figure very strongly in her heritage. Hence, she has moved to Europe in a bid to broaden her cultural sensibilities with respect to her song writing and life. Never one to rest on her laurels, Jess is looking to incorporate traditional instruments into her music to further diversify her musical palette – an exciting prospect, as her music already shows a diversity and maturity that totally belies her age. As clichéd as it sounds, Jess is quite literally going on a musical journey of sorts. And whilst she will no doubt benefit as she continues to grow as an amazing songwriter, we, her audience, have the pleasure of being able to absorb her output as she continues to expand her musical capacities.
